custom software development green bay

custom software development green bay


Table of Contents

custom software development green bay

Green Bay, Wisconsin, boasts a thriving business community, and for businesses to stay competitive, leveraging technology is crucial. Custom software development offers a powerful solution, allowing companies to automate processes, improve efficiency, and gain a significant edge over competitors. This guide explores the benefits of custom software development in Green Bay and answers common questions businesses have about this essential service.

What are the Benefits of Custom Software Development?

Choosing custom software development over off-the-shelf solutions offers several key advantages. Firstly, customizability is paramount. A tailored software solution precisely addresses your specific business needs, unlike generic software that may require workarounds or compromises. This leads to increased efficiency and productivity, as processes are streamlined and optimized.

Secondly, scalability is inherent in well-designed custom software. As your business grows, your software can grow with it, adapting to changing requirements and preventing the need for costly replacements down the line. Furthermore, custom software provides a competitive advantage, offering unique functionalities that differentiate your business and enhance your brand. Finally, custom solutions offer superior security, as the software can be designed with your specific security protocols in mind, protecting your valuable data.

How Much Does Custom Software Development Cost in Green Bay?

The cost of custom software development varies significantly based on several factors. The complexity of the project, the features required, the development timeline, and the experience of the development team all influence the final price. While it's impossible to give a precise figure without a detailed project scope, understanding these contributing factors will allow for better budgeting. It's always recommended to obtain detailed quotes from several reputable Green Bay software development companies.

What are the Stages Involved in Custom Software Development?

The process typically involves several key stages:

  1. Requirement Gathering and Analysis: This crucial first step involves detailed discussions with the client to understand their specific needs, goals, and expectations.
  2. Design and Planning: Once requirements are clearly defined, the development team creates a detailed plan outlining the software's architecture, functionality, and user interface.
  3. Development: The actual coding and building of the software takes place during this phase.
  4. Testing and Quality Assurance: Rigorous testing is crucial to ensure the software functions correctly, efficiently, and meets the client's specifications. This includes unit testing, integration testing, and user acceptance testing (UAT).
  5. Deployment and Launch: Once testing is complete, the software is deployed to the client's environment, and the final product is launched.
  6. Maintenance and Support: Ongoing maintenance and support are essential to address any bugs, provide updates, and ensure the software continues to function optimally.

What Types of Businesses Benefit Most from Custom Software?

Nearly any business can benefit from custom software, but certain industries see particularly significant advantages. These include businesses with unique workflows, specialized data management needs, or the requirement for highly secure systems. Examples include healthcare providers, financial institutions, manufacturing companies, and e-commerce businesses. The key is identifying processes that are inefficient or could be significantly improved through automation and tailored software solutions.

How Do I Find a Reputable Custom Software Development Company in Green Bay?

Choosing the right development partner is crucial. Look for companies with a proven track record, positive client testimonials, and a team of experienced developers. Consider their expertise in relevant technologies and their ability to clearly communicate project progress. Thoroughly researching companies, reviewing their portfolios, and asking for references will greatly increase the likelihood of finding a reliable and effective partner.

What Technologies Are Commonly Used in Custom Software Development?

The specific technologies used vary depending on project requirements, but some common choices include:

  • Programming Languages: Java, Python, C#, PHP, JavaScript
  • Databases: MySQL, PostgreSQL, SQL Server, MongoDB
  • Frameworks: React, Angular, Node.js, .NET

By carefully considering these factors and selecting a reputable Green Bay-based software development company, businesses can leverage the power of custom software to achieve significant improvements in efficiency, productivity, and competitive advantage. Remember, investing in custom software is an investment in your business's future.